How Automated 2D Wire Bending Machines Work


Automated 2D wire bending machines operate using a series of programmed instructions that guide the bending process. The key components include:
- **Control Software**: Users can input designs and specifications into the machine's control system, which interprets these instructions and executes the bending process with high precision.
- **Bending Mechanism**: The machine utilizes a series of tools to bend the wire according to the specified angles and dimensions, ensuring consistency across production runs.
- **Feeding System**: Wire is automatically fed into the machine, reducing manual handling and increasing overall efficiency.
This sophisticated integration of technology allows for rapid adjustments and the ability to produce complex wire shapes with minimal human intervention.

Precision and Accuracy


One of the standout features of automated 2D wire bending machines is their ability to deliver exceptional precision. Unlike manual methods, which are prone to human error, these machines ensure that each bend is executed flawlessly. This level of accuracy is crucial in industries such as automotive, aerospace, and electronics, where even the smallest deviation can lead to product failure or safety hazards.

Enhanced Efficiency


Time is money, particularly in manufacturing. Automated 2D wire bending machines drastically reduce production times. They are capable of completing in minutes what would take human operators hours, thereby increasing throughput. Furthermore, these machines can operate continuously, allowing for around-the-clock production with minimal downtime.

Cost Savings


While the initial investment in automated 2D wire bending machines may be significant, the long-term cost savings are substantial. By improving efficiency and precision, these machines help to reduce material waste and errors, leading to lower production costs. Additionally, businesses can save on labor costs since fewer operators are needed to oversee the bending process.

Flexibility and Customization


Automated 2D wire bending machines are incredibly versatile. They can be programmed to produce a wide range of shapes and sizes, making them suitable for various applications. Whether a business needs to produce a simple hook or a complex framework, these machines can be easily adjusted to accommodate different requirements. This flexibility allows manufacturers to respond quickly to changing market demands and customer preferences.

Increased Safety Features


Safety is paramount in any manufacturing environment. Automated 2D wire bending machines are designed with numerous safety features that protect operators from potential hazards. These include emergency stop buttons, safety guards, and advanced sensors that can detect errors or malfunctions. By minimizing human involvement in potentially dangerous tasks, these machines contribute to a safer workplace.

Applications of Automated 2D Wire Bending Machines


The versatility of automated 2D wire bending machines enables their use across various industries. Some of the most common applications include:
- **Automotive Industry**: Used for producing wire harnesses, brackets, and other components.
- **Aerospace**: Ideal for creating lightweight, high-strength structural components.
- **Furniture Manufacturing**: Used for making frames and supports.
- **Electronics**: Producing intricate wire shapes for circuit boards and connectors.
Each application benefits uniquely from the precision, efficiency, and flexibility of these machines, enhancing overall product quality and production speed.

FAQs About Automated 2D Wire Bending Machines


1. What types of wire can be used with automated 2D wire bending machines?


Most machines can handle a variety of wire types, including steel, aluminum, brass, and copper, depending on the specific model and capabilities.

2. How much does an automated 2D wire bending machine cost?


The cost can vary widely based on features, capabilities, and brand but can range from several thousand to several hundred thousand dollars.

3. Is training required to operate these machines?


Yes, training is typically necessary to ensure proper operation and to maximize the machine's potential.

4. Can automated 2D wire bending machines be used for prototyping?


Absolutely! Many manufacturers use these machines for rapid prototyping due to their flexibility and speed.

5. How do I maintain an automated 2D wire bending machine?


Regular maintenance involves cleaning, checking for wear and tear, and ensuring that the software is up to date. Following the manufacturer's guidelines is essential for optimal performance.
